已解决pyautogui.FailSafeException: PyAutoGUI-Failsafe wird ausgelöst, wenn sich die Maus in eine Ecke des s bewegt



Das Python-Pyautogui-Modul, das die Maus bedient, löste eine Ausnahme aus: pyautogui.FailSafeException: PyAutoGUI-Fail-Safe wird ausgelöst, wenn sich die Maus in eine Ecke des Bildschirms bewegt. Um diese Fail-Safe zu deaktivieren, setzen Sie pyautogui.FAILSAFE auf False. FAIL-SAFE DEAKTIVIEREN IST NICHT EMPFOHLEN. Die richtige Lösung, der persönliche Test ist wirksam! ! !









Fehlermeldung



Ein kleiner Freund stieß auf ein Problem und schickte mir eine private Nachricht. Er wollte das Python-Pyautogui-Modul zum Bedienen der Maus verwenden, aber es trat ein Fehler auf (zu diesem Zeitpunkt war sein Herz für einen Moment kalt, er kam zu mir und bat mich um Hilfe). Und dann habe ich ihm erfolgreich geholfen, das Problem zu lösen. Ich hoffe, es kann mehr Freunden helfen, die auf diesen Fehler stoßen und ihn nicht lösen können. Der Fehlercode lautet wie folgt:


import pyautogui

startPosition = (859, 420)
endPosition = (1139, 443)
# 移动鼠标到起始位置
pyautogui.moveTo(startPosition[0], startPosition[1])
# 按住鼠标左键
pyautogui.mouseDown()
# 移动鼠标到结束位置
pyautogui.moveTo(endPosition[0], endPosition[1], duration=1)
# 松开鼠标左键
time.sleep(0.5)
pyautogui.mouseUp()

Der Inhalt der Fehlermeldung lautet wie folgt :

pyautogui.FailSafeException: PyAutoGUI fail-safe triggered from mouse moving to a corner of the screen. To disable this fail-safe, set pyautogui.FAILSAFE to False. DISABLING FAIL-SAFE IS NOT RECOMMENDED.



Fehlerübersetzung



Die Übersetzung des Inhalts der Fehlermeldung lautet wie folgt :

pyautogui.failsafeException: pyautogui failsafe wird ausgelöst, wenn sich die Maus in die Ecke des Bildschirms bewegt. Um diese Ausfallsicherheit zu deaktivieren, setzen Sie pyautogui.FAILSAFE auf False. Die Deaktivierung von Failsafe wird nicht empfohlen.




Fehlergrund



Fehlerursache :


Pyautogui Failsafe wird ausgelöst, wenn sich die Maus in die Ecke des Bildschirms bewegt.

Freunde, befolgen Sie die untenstehende Methode, um das Problem zu lösen! ! !




Lösung



Das Hinzufügen dieser Zeile zum Code löst das Problem :

pyautogui.FAILSAFE=False

Das Obige ist die Lösung für die Ursache dieses Fehlers. Hinterlassen Sie gerne eine Nachricht im Kommentarbereich, um zu besprechen, ob das Problem behoben werden kann.Wenn es nützlich ist, liken und sammeln Sie den Artikel. Vielen Dank für Ihre Unterstützung. Der Blogger hat die Motivation, die aufgetretenen Probleme weiterhin aufzuzeichnen.!!!

Tausende Full-Stack-VIP-Frage-und-Antwort-Gruppen kontaktieren Blogger und helfen bei der Lösung von Fehlern

Aufgrund der begrenzten Zeit und Energie von Bloggern gibt es jeden Tag zu viele private Nachrichten und es gibt nicht die Möglichkeit, dass jeder Fan rechtzeitig antwortet, daher haben VIP-Fans Vorrang bei der Beantwortung. Sie können am Full-Stack mit tausend Personen teilnehmen Durch Abonnieren der zeitlich begrenzten 9,9-Kolumne „100 Days Mastering Python from Getting Started to Employment“ VIP-Antwortgruppe, erhalten Sie vorrangige Antwortmöglichkeiten (Code-Anleitung, Remote-Service), kostenlose Prostitution 80G-Lernmaterialien Spree, Kolumnen-Abonnementadresse: https: //blog.csdn.net/yuan2019035055/category_11466020.html

  • Vorteile :Der Autor räumt den Antwortmöglichkeiten Vorrang ein (Code-Anleitung, Remote-Service), und viele große Persönlichkeiten in der Gruppe können zusammenhalten, um warm zu bleiben (interne Werbemöglichkeit für große Fabriken). Diese Kolumne ist ein vollständiger Lehrsatz, der speziell für Studenten ohne Grundkenntnisse vorbereitet wurde und diejenigen, die eine fortgeschrittene Verbesserung benötigen: Von 0 auf 100, weiter voranschreiten und vertiefen, und im Anschluss wird es praktische Projekte geben, damit Sie problemlos mit Vorstellungsgesprächen umgehen können!

  • Vorteile der Säule :Lebenslaufberatung, interne Empfehlung für die Einstellung, wöchentliche Lieferung physischer Bücher, 80G Full-Stack-Lernvideos, 300 IT-E-Books: Python, Java, Front-End, Big Data, Datenbank, Algorithmus, Crawler, Datenanalyse, maschinelles Lernen, Interviewfragenbank usw.

  • Hinweis : Wenn Sie eine zeitnahe Antwort erhalten, mit den Großen kommunizieren und lernen möchten, senden Sie nach dem Abonnieren der Kolumne eine private Nachricht an den Blogger, um der VIP-Fragen- und Antwortgruppe mit Tausenden von Menschen beizutretenFügen Sie hier eine Bildbeschreibung ein
    Fügen Sie hier eine Bildbeschreibung ein

Kostenlose Informationsbeschaffung, weitere Fanvorteile, folgen Sie dem offiziellen Konto unten, um es zu erhalten

Fügen Sie hier eine Bildbeschreibung ein

おすすめ

転載: blog.csdn.net/yuan2019035055/article/details/129197782